HOW DO PLAYERS QUALIFY_

Every player eligible to play in a Tennis Masters Series event is automatically entered into the draw. Entry is determined by a player's position on the ATP Entry System exactly 42 days before the tournament starts.

Additionally, players will enter the main draw through the qualifying competition. Others will gain direct entry through wild cards awarded at the tournament's discretion. The number of qualifying positions and wild cards depend on the draw size of the tournament (see below).

If eligible to play in one of Tennis Masters Series events, a player must count the points from these tournaments, even if it is a zero because he missed the event. (The same is true for Grand Slam events.) Just as in Formula One and numerous other sports, if a competitor misses a race or an event, he loses his chance to earn points.
